North Valley Shooters Association operates a shooting range at 1098b E. Gridley Rd, Gridley, CA 95948 that hosts four distinct competitive shooting formats. The range runs on a cold range policy—no ammunition loaded unless supervised by a certified safety officer.

USPSA (3rd Sunday Monthly)

United States Practical Shooting Association matches run on the third Sunday. USPSA events have you shoot targets while moving through stages with walls, fault lines, and props. You're racing against the clock while maintaining accuracy. Competitors are separated by gun division (Open, Limited, Limited 10, Production, Revolver) and skill class (Grand Master, Master, A, B, C, D, Unclassified). First-timers start Unclassified and move up after shooting 4 classifier stages. Registration via PractiScore.

IDPA (4th Sunday Monthly)

International Defensive Pistol Association matches use practical self-defense scenarios. Founded in 1996 as an alternative to IPSC, IDPA stresses equipment that's actually useful for self-defense rather than competition-only gear. You can be competitive with a stock service pistol and standard holster. Scoring is time plus penalties. Matches start with a new shooter briefing at 8:45–9:00 AM. Arrive by 8:30 AM to get set up. Registration via PractiScore.

IDPA was founded because competition shooting had become too focused on heavily modified guns and specialized equipment. The founders—Bill Wilson, John Sayle, Ken Hackathorn, Dick Thomas, Walt Rauch, and Larry Vickers—wanted a sport where a standard defensive pistol was competitive.

ICORE (2nd Sunday, December–May)

International Confederation of Revolver Enthusiasts competition runs revolver-only matches December through May on the second Sunday. ICORE was founded in 1991 by Mike and Sharon Higashi to provide an alternative to the equipment arms race in action shooting. Semi-autos and PCCs are now welcome. Scoring uses time plus penalties/bonuses. NRA D-1 paper targets and falling steel plates are used. Charlie Severance serves as interim Match Director. Registration via PractiScore.

NVSA Steel Matches

NVSA Steel is designed as an accessible entry point for families, casual shooters, and serious competitors alike. These "shoot-what-you-brung" events accept most handgun calibers (.45 ACP 1911s, 22LR, revolvers, semi-autos) and rifle types (lever action, pumps, semi-autos, single shot). Stages are designed to be safe and simple—not trick courses. Match directors set their own courses within safety guidelines. You typically shoot each stage 5 times. Having 5 magazines per gun helps, but loaner magazines are usually available. The focus is fun and safety, not complexity.

CategoryDetails
Physical Address1098b E. Gridley Rd, Gridley, CA 95948
Mailing AddressNVSA INC, 7250 Auburn Blvd Ste. 117, Citrus Heights, CA 95610
Membership Cost$25 single / $40 family (same household)
Membership PeriodJuly 1 – June 30 annually
Gate CardRequired for vehicle entry (electronic gate monitored by City of Gridley)
Guest PassesTwo guest cards available per match director for first-time visitors
  • Important: Gate cards cannot be shared between vehicles. No tailgating or following other cars through the gate—the gate is video monitored. Every person in a family membership needs a gate card for their vehicle.

New shooters should contact the match director before arriving to arrange entry with a guest pass. Current members renewing should handwrite "Activate July 1st" on the Boat Ramp Application if they want the card active the same dates as membership.

If your card expires or stops working, contact City of Gridley directly at 685 Kentucky Street, Gridley, CA 95948 or (530) 846-5695.

All new shooters are welcome to watch matches free of charge. Come early to help with setup. Each discipline has its own classifications and skill levels, so beginners shoot alongside experienced competitors in separate categories.

All matches use PractiScore for registration and scoring. Signup links for USPSA, IDPA, ICORE, and Steel matches are available through the NVSA website.
